Description:
A worm virus is a self replicating malware program created to infect local and network computers to install harmful payloads. Worms usually spread by exploiting vulnerabilities on the compromised computer. A worm virus may degrade system security, carry out different malicious behavior and steal sensitive information such as system actions, login names, passwords or contact information. Common worms spread through spam e-mail, file-sharing networks, messenger programs or through removable drivers.
